On the Exact Eigenstates and the Ground States Based on the Boson Realization for Many-Quark Model with su(4) Algebraic Structure

摘要

Based on the boson realization, the ground state and phase structure are investigated in a many-quark model with algebraic structure developed in our previous paper, in which the two-body pairing and particle-hole type interactions are active. The physical interpretation of the exact eigenstates obtained in the boson realization in our previous paper is given in a many-quark model with su(4) algebraic structure.
机译:基于玻色子实现,我们在先前的论文中开发的具有代数结构的多夸克模型中研究了基态和相结构,其中两体配对和粒子-孔类型相互作用是活跃的。我们在前一篇论文的玻色子实现中获得的精确本征态的物理解释是在具有su(4)代数结构的多夸克模型中给出的。
